Barra dinâmica do governo brasileiro. Nesse projeto está incluído o código da barra e do rodapé de governo.
O exemplo de como utilizar a barra no seu sítio está publicado em Manual da Barra do Governo Brasileiro. A página de testes está disponível em Teste da Barra do Governo Brasileiro. Você pode contribuir e melhorar o exemplo no Código do Manual da Barra do Governo Brasileiro.
Copie o profile 'vaso' e altere os arquivos referentes a campanha ou a barra e crie um pull request.
Mande sua sugestão para secom.comunicacaodigital@presidencia.gov.br com cópia para identidade-digital@listas.softwarepublico.gov.br e sugira um PR.
Execute o make com o parâmetro de PROFILE. Exemplo:
PROFILE=outubrorosa make run
python2.7
io.js
sass
zlib
make venv
E execute o
make profile
O Vagrant vai criar o ambiente de desenvolvimento.
vagrant up
vagrant ssh
cd barra-govbr
Execute o comando:
PROFILE=outubrorosa make run
O profile selecionado é o outubrorosa nesse exemplo
Execute o comando:
make teste
Para gerar um teste em XUNIT execute
make testReport
Internet Explorer versão 11 ou superior
Mozilla Firefox versão 24
Google Chrome versão C30
Safari versão S6
Opera versão 12
Navegadores de dispositivos móveis
A Barra deve degradar graciosamente (graceful degradation ou progressive enhancement) clientes que não possuam compatibilidade ou no qual o javascript esteja desligado.
A barra deve ser acessível.
A Barra deve conter tanto o rodapé como a barra.
A barra será hospedada em local centralizado e chamada de forma distribuída pelos portais institucionais;
A barra será incluída via javascript minificado.
O rodapé será incluído via javascript minificado.